跨链关键技艺—以太坊的关联分区介绍

区块律动BlockBeats新闻,Cosmos区块链最注重的建立之一IBC跨链左券已经做到了最尾部的本事开垦,应用层合同仍未完结支付,譬喻跨链转账七个剧中人物的经济激情及惩处机制还会有待开荒。那象征以前暴光的Cosmos
IBC跨链公约就要三月上线的音讯落空,乐观预测须要等待二零二零年工夫贯彻IBC的上线。Cosmos跨链协议IBC是永葆Cosmos跨链的显要插件。IBC创造了完整的互通双向“侧链”,允许价值跨链举办传递,并丰硕利用Tendermint的当即最后性来得以达成代币的全速传递。科兹莫s
IBC是围绕Cosmos互连网和Tendermint共鸣引擎而安插的。

但是,比特币和以太坊都不持有实时最后性;他们都以可能率最后性。[注:直到不久的现在Casper
the Friendly Finality Gadget 达成后,以太坊全部最后性。]
可能率最后性意味着,随着有个别区块后边的链的长短的增加,那条链也就更不易于被重新协会,也就更能让大家相信那个区块是“最终的”。然而因为概率最后性不能够完全幸免区块链的再次组织,所以经过IBC公约安全地跨链转移资金是不可行的。那就提议了贰个难题:Cosmos分区是何等与已经存在的不抱有最后性的区块链进行互操作的。

碳链价值:在怎么钱袋里,大家得以储存cosmos的代币Atom;在怎么着交易所上,大家能够交易这几个代币?

仿佛有多个品类基于 Cosmos Hub 开垦形似,作为主 Hub,如今也会有广大门类基于
IHighlanderISnet 展开,完成本身的遍布式商业利用的供给。

牵连分区是Cosmos的缓和方案。贰个挂钩分区是一条依照账户的区块链,它将Cosmos中的分区与像Bitcoin、Ethereum那样的外表的区块链连接起来。它扮演了四个适配器分区的剧中人物;或许是像在Casper解说中说的那样,它是一个“最后性工具”。通过设定三个“最终性阈值”,当区块链中新增添一定数量的区块后以为区块链具备了伪最后性。日常的话,这种“连接”分区设计能够被认为是一种两路挂钩。

在实验室的条件,曾经做过证实,
Cosmos底层Tendermint的内燃机是能够扶助千数量级的TPS,因为在实验室意况之中有着飞跃的服务器,节点数量日常比较简单,而且它们之间的互联网连接也卓殊可信赖,以笔者之见,千数量级的TPS去支持商用,那就曾经够用了。

如上海教室为例,图中最右侧和最右边的 4 条公链在并未有 Hub
的情事下要促成连接,就亟须在相互之间新建一条大道,但若是有了
Hub,它们都只须要与 Hub 连接,由 Hub 达成跨链的转载。

以太坊联系分区将是Cosmos中率先批达成的这种分区之一。它与基于EVM的Ethermint特差别,Ethermint分离了依据PoW的挖矿,然后在Tendermint共识机制和新的互联网左券栈之上完成原本以太坊的效劳。而以太坊挂钩分区会使得ERC20代币和以太币能够在原生的以太坊和Cosmos网络中连连的装有分区通过IBC转移。

碳链价值:为何要用一个双Hub的构造吧?

本文首发于Wechat大伙儿号:链闻ChainNews。作品内容属作者个人观点,不意味着今日头条网立场。投资者据此操作,风险请自担。

图片 1Peggy
的 5 个 组成都部队分

碳链价值:IRIS和Cosmos是叁个怎么着关联吧?

PlasmaChain 则是以 Zone 和 Hub 的双重身份现身,它是以太坊的 DPoS 侧链。

在Cosmos中,因为我们得以接受IBC合同转移任何加密资金财产,所以轻便实行互操作。然则,在Cosmos和以太坊之间调换加密货币在工夫上是十二分复杂的,那是因为IBC数据包不能够以太坊中被飞速的解码。那又是因为EVM未有被设计成与IBC包容。那一个标题独有Peggy技巧减轻

Harriet:双Hub构造,更去中央化,更便于扩大,更具安全性。至于为什么不创制八个恐怕多个Hub,那件事的一步步来。大家得先验证多少个Hub能专门的学问,再对那些模型实行增加。今后上线的
Cosmos Hub和 ISportageIS Hub 之间还不可能通信,因为跨链左券 IBC
还只有原型设计,未遂完毕。

图片 2

2018-02-27 Cosmos 互联链 跨链关键技能—以太坊的联系分区介绍

Harriet:现阶段可以利用ledger Nano 和
Yubihsm那个硬件卡包。假设想要跟互连网发出相互,不管是寄托依旧此外界分操作,都是经过命令行的办法来支撑的。大家支撑了Cosmos本领文书档案的汉语翻译,也在github上发布了有个别Cosmos
围绕委托的中文表明,随后我们也会在公众号上给大家大吃大喝出去。款待大家关切。

但是,最稀少多个标本可供观望:Cosmos 与 PolkaDot。

  • 类别化格式:Tendermint的种类化对象的编码方法是go-wire。以太坊用的是奥德赛LP
    (Recursive Length Prefix卡塔尔。
  • 签名方案:Tendermint使用的是ed25519,而以太坊用的是secp256k1。
  • 数据构造:Tendermint把键值对存在IAVL+树中,而以太坊把它们存在Patricia树中。

Harriet:I本田UR-VISnet是 Cosmos 基金会 ICF 为了促成多 HUB
的愿景,援救支付的其它三个跨链项目,Cosmos
在协和的官方网站介绍自身时对那几个做了介绍: I奔驰G级ISnet 是Cosmos
大跨链生态中的其余多个Cosmos HUB,
它扶助跨链服务,也将推进去中央化商业使用的营造。

互联网层:底层的数据结交涉通讯左券的计划。

像Tendermint
Core那样的共鸣引擎提供了实时最后性。假诺想越来越好的打听它是什么行事的,请阅读有关Tendermint共鸣的越多内容

碳链价值:假若本人依据cosmos发链,那么小编批发的链质量会受到cosmos主链的制约吗?

Cosmos 在 3 月 14 日的早 7:00 运营主网,它是以伯克利的 Tendermint
团队为基本团队开拓的跨链项目,要促成两件职业:第一件,是让公链开荒变得轻松;第二件,是让全部的链能够连接起来。

以下是模块深入分析:

正文头阵于微信公众号:碳链价值。小说内容属小编个人观点,不代表博客园网立场。投资人据此操作,风险请自担。

参照他事他说加以调查资料及数码来自:

[ 以太坊 ] <- ETGate -> [ Cosmos枢纽 ]

碳链价值:Cosmos今后的TPS大约是稍微呢?

它是怎样成功这两件工作的?以这两件职业的落到实处为底工,Cosmos
希望营造出什么的区块链世界?它的跨链生态方今的开展怎么着?本文将次第解答那么些主题材料。

介意识到大家得以透过把解析转变机制放在EVM之外,即定制的区块链中成就,此情势将节约大批量瓦斯,Peggy的规划思路就变得清楚了。

公网络情形更是复杂,种种节点配置差异,通信带宽也不均等。Cosmos
和IPAJEROISnet都以永葆完全开放的九18个评释节点,具备特别强的去宗旨化。节点越多,共识功效就能够裁减。

最被世家熟谙的相应是 IGL450ISnet,它由中华的疆界智能团队开拓,是当下 Cosmos
网络中除 Cosmos Hub 外的最主要的五个 Hub。

联系分区的细则还在付出中,你可以关心它的Github代码库:Peggy,下边是旅舍链接。

从此我们完结本身应用链业务须求会变得愈加轻易,基本上可以一键发链,然后在提供的接口上可以更敏捷地潜心于本身职业领域供给。

Hub 自己也是一条公链,使用 Cosmos SDK 开荒,具有 tendermint 构造;Hub
连接的公链甚至公链的代理链被称作「Zone」,全体的 Zone 都须要完成 IBC
通讯职业。

ETGate的酌量消耗多量计量能源,因为它在EVM中解码IBC数据包。IBC数据包中的情节是Tendermint头、交易、IAVL+树评释和ed25519签定。

其次,Cosmos第二大进献,正是Cosmos SDK。Cosmos
SDK是七个可怜模块化的软件开拓工具包,你能够特别轻松地安插你的区块链,然后能够依靠本身的选择需要营造应用专有链。

Ethermint 是一个独立的 Zone,基于 Tendermint ,何况完全匹配以太坊的 web3
接口和 RPC 调用方法,其跨链实现是:以太坊延续 Ethermint Zone,Ethermint
连接 Cosmos Hub,Cosmos Hub 连接别的遵从 IBC 通讯职业的
Zone/链。通过这种连接关系,最后兑现以太的跨链转移。

  1. 首先从科兹莫s枢纽中发轫。你先经过IBC左券把有个别Photon转移到联系分区中。挂钩分区接受到传播的IBC数据包:三个蕴含发送Photon代币的新闻。签名者监视着这几个关系分区而且对那么些IBC交易实行签订协议,高效的把那几个签字调换为以太坊能剖析的secp256k1格式的私钥。那样一来,你的交易就在联系分区上达成了签名。
  2. 关切那个关系分区的中继器等到他俩看来超过2/3的签字者这一个交易实行了具名,然后将你签定的贸易批量管理为经过IBC发送的富有别的贸易的清单。然后他们把附有签字的列表转载到以太坊智能合约运转的EVM上。
  3. 以太坊智能合约接下去检查交易列表是或不是有效。针对Photon智能合约会变卦它的ERC20版本。智能合约产生ERC20
    Photon之后,它将ERC20 Photon发送到你在以太坊主网中的地址上。
  4. 这时候,你能够一本万利地由此举例0x protocol或是OmiseGO那样的ERC20
    去宗旨化交易所把ERC20 Photons 调换来ETH。

有关这几个去中央化交易所真正能够跟跨链生态能够统统融入,还应该有待大家地方提到的第三点Cosmos价值点:IBC,也正是跨链通信左券的多谋善算者。那也是大家在第二季度供给相当小心地要去贯彻的三个指标,那正是对IBC的兑现拉动,那样的话那么些去大旨化交易所才不会形成荒岛,它工夫够充足有效的跟任何的跨链生态连通。

经过定制的
Hub,进一层简化开采工作和知足特定领域的支付须要,并促成除代币跨链外的更多跨链的或者。

当直面Tendermint和以太坊使用不一样的零器件的标题时,这种规划是特别不实用的。Tendermint中利用的每一个幼功零器件都与以太坊中的功底零件不宽容。事实表明,尝试征服EVM中的包容性难点,扩充区块创设流程的老本特别高昂。

脚下科兹莫s的区块时间明日是6.69s。

精晓 Cosmos 跨链,最器重的是询问 IBC Inter-Blockchain Communication,即
Cosmos 的跨链通讯左券。

Peggy有三个卷曲的起来。

碳链价值:如何对待Cosmos的另二个竞争者Polkadot?

跨链是区块链精确的演变大势呢?万链互连是区块链现在的出生意况呢?不明了。大家都在阅览。

首先个尝试把Cosmos和以太坊连接起来的是叁个叫ETGate的红客Marathon项目。ETGate就好像一个“油乌菟”同样,须求多量的总计财富。ETGate是由
Joon设计的。他是第4届HackAtom的大奖取得者。他也参预了Cosmos开采Peggy。

Harriet:会的,但大家真正必要先证实多少个HUB能很好的搭档,那在那之中有技巧难题要减轻,也论及到通证经济的规划。个中二个很风趣的是验证是多
HUB之间的相互作用安全援救,例如以后大家的I冠道IS的通证中留给了 5% 通证给Cosmos
通证持有者。但那不是粗略的远投,是预先流出来促成 Cosmos和IEvoqueIS
hub间安全扶持的,那将会让 Cosmos Hub 能通过这 5% ITucsonIS通证抵押在 I哈弗IS
hub扶植做安全认证,当然Cosmos 的通证持有者也能够大饱眼福 ISportageIS Hub
的出块奖励。这对于IPAJEROISnet 来讲会有 5% 的通证是不流动的,然后能够分享到
科兹莫s Hub
验证人提供的安全认证服务。当然,多Hub布局及其相应的通证经济,具备研究和立异的恐怕。一同始从双
HUB开首运行,等到那样的表达成熟后,现在跨链生态就足以支撑越来越多的Hub。

2.《对话
Cosmos:今后是全体人都用一条公链,依然各样人都有本身的链?》,李阳

以太坊智能合约一旦陈设之后就不可能修改,因而拾分难以更新。在智能合约更新管理方面还贫乏组织结构。佩格gy的前进路线图倒逼大家应对这种不生硬,但那是大家期望能够发出实际实施方案的一个探究世界。

Harriet:Polkadot在Cosmos 之后安插,一初叶就借鉴了Cosmos/Tendermint
的有个别好的动感,所以在规划上更周详。比方Cosmos 的统筹注意通证跨链转移,
Polkadot 的跨链也能支撑数据跨链使用。当然围绕数据和复杂性计算跨链,I大切诺基ISnet
给出了布置,那也是对科兹莫s生态的二个市场股票总值进步。

Cosmos主网,让跨链生态从理论阶段步向贯彻阶段

正在扩充的干活

Harriet:Cosmos为产业界带来的孝敬,笔者以为能够依据三个地点来谈。

最终,如下图所示,通过对公链的分段设计以及对应用层的分模块设计,开垦者能够以
tendermint 共鸣引擎和 Cosmos SDK
开垦工具为根底,飞快地完结公链的开销。他们不再须要兼顾整条公链,而只供给完成中心的思想政治工作职能。

跨链加密货币资产转变是支付协会在Cosmos中贯彻的主导作用。在Cosmos生态中,加密资金能够透过IBC公约进行转移。IBC左券是一种能够推向互操作本事的跨链通讯左券(Inter-Blockchain
Communication
protocol卡塔尔(قطر‎。值得说的是,IBC协议独有在转出和转入区块链都具有实时最终性时本事使用

碳链价值:如果IEvoqueIS和Cosmos之间可以专业,现在会考虑引进愈来愈多的Hub吗?

IBC
定义了链与链之间的通讯职业,或许说它定义了一种跨链构造,具有同等布局的链就能够完结相互影响衔接,它同意区块链读取和验证同布局的别的链上的风浪。

  • Cosmos GitHub: Peggy:

关于地点提到的连结环节,还提到到这一个通证在她本身原生链里面包车型客车交易,什么时候能够真正有最终分明状态。而笔者辈领会,像比特币网络和以太坊网络,他们都不具备即时最后性,那其间的进程不是由跨链生态能够支配得了的。

ISportageISnet 是 Cosmos 在神州的技能和营业同盟同伙边界智能作为基本开垦公司,与
Tendermint 研究开发集团同盟构建的贰个Hub,其指标是成为链接数字经济和实业经济的可信赖「桥梁」,为创设复杂的遍布式商业使用提供满意这种特定需要的公链根底设备。

ETGate最早尝试直接将Cosmos枢纽和以太坊连接起来的。它尝试扩张EVM本人的宽容性。好似这么:

征集撰稿:唐晗

那样一来,开拓者在进展应用层开垦时,只须要实现自笔者业务逻辑中独特的成效,其他的职能都能够直接调用
Cosmos 的效能模块。